Sorts Of Paint Finishes
When it comes to paint coatings, there are 5 primary kinds you need to understand about: level,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ind offers a details purpose and can drastically influence the look of your area.
Flat coatings have a matte look, making them excellent for hiding flaws on wall surfaces. They're perfect for ceilings or low-traffic areas but can be challenging to clean.
Eggshell coatings offer a minor sheen, offering even more resilience while still being forgiving on imperfections. They're excellent for living spaces or bedrooms.
Satin finishes are preferred for their soft shine, making them functional for different applications, consisting of bathroom and kitchens. They're easier to clean than flat or eggshell coatings, making them functional for high-traffic areas.
Semi-gloss coatings supply a noticeable sparkle, which functions well for trim, moldings, and cupboards. They're extremely long lasting and simple to wipe down, best for rooms prone to moisture.
Finally, gloss finishes have a reflective, glossy surface, making them appropriate for accent items or furniture.
Understanding these kinds of paint finishes will help you make notified choices for your next paint project.
